When you turn the radio on, if the display screen shows only a picture of your car it is the Performance Sound Audio System.
I take it that because can't find an Aux Input, you must have the factory fitted Bluetooth Handsfree System. This is how Volvo currently roll out the audio systems on their cars: Performance Sound with Aux Input. Performance Sound + Bluetooth Handsfree with no Aux Input. High Performance Sound with USB & Aux Input. (with or without Bluetooth) Premium Sound with USB & Aux Input. (with or without Bluetooth) If you want iPod connection you will need to fit the iPod Interface, better to fit the Combined USB/iPod Interface while you're at it. Don't even think of changing the head unit, it uses Media Oriented Systems Transport (MOST) and Volvo have made it almost impossible to upgrade it. Peugeot will give you a build in SatNav and Bluetooth for £800 with Volvo double it or more depending on how the car is specified.
